I am looking for information about my Great Grandfather : 12590 L/Sgt George James Lang who served in the Worcestershire Reg. in WW1.

He was awarded the Croix de Guerre in 1918 which I have found in the London Gazette. We are now trying to find out what the award was for (beyond family rumour).

Is there anyway I can find a citation or more information about this? we believe he was a signaller.
